X-Git-Url: https://git.pterodactylus.net/?a=blobdiff_plain;f=src%2Fmain%2Fjava%2Fnet%2Fpterodactylus%2Fsone%2Ftext%2FFreenetLinkParser.java;h=4b88acc77e4d82bb59f7facbea262e0b12dd3143;hb=99f81eb82982d630a9a9990e27c7cc8ea30563ce;hp=0f6887d232598d93625812599f9d2f32c2365e7b;hpb=bf47af32fc2322b651b12b01f969fbeda6d33f3e;p=Sone.git diff --git a/src/main/java/net/pterodactylus/sone/text/FreenetLinkParser.java b/src/main/java/net/pterodactylus/sone/text/FreenetLinkParser.java index 0f6887d..4b88acc 100644 --- a/src/main/java/net/pterodactylus/sone/text/FreenetLinkParser.java +++ b/src/main/java/net/pterodactylus/sone/text/FreenetLinkParser.java @@ -265,7 +265,7 @@ public class FreenetLinkParser implements Parser { } else if (linkType == LinkType.POST) { String postId = link.substring(7); Post post = core.getPost(postId, false); - if (post != null) { + if ((post != null) && (post.getSone() != null)) { String postText = post.getText(); postText = postText.substring(0, Math.min(postText.length(), 20)) + "…"; Sone postSone = post.getSone();